Choose the most suitable answer and write the corresponding


letter (A,B,C, or D) in the brackets provided.
1. A copper rod expands when its temperature _____________________.
(A) remains constant
(B) falls
(C) rises
(D) is equal to its melting point
2. For the same increase in temperature ___________________.
(A) Solids expand less than liquids but more than gases
(B) Solids expand more than liquids but less than gases
(C) Liquids expand less than solids but more than gases
(D) Liquids expand more than solids but less than gases
3. When heat is absorbed by a body, it _______________.
(A) Expands with a large pushing force
(B) Expands with a large pulling force
(C) Contracts with a large pushing force
(D) Contracts with a large pulling force
4. Some telephone lines snap at night because _____________.
(A) They contract
(B) They expand
(C) They contract and then expand
(D) They expand and then contract
5. A bimetallic thermometer works on the principle of ________________.
(A) Same rates of expansion of a metal
(B) Different rates of expansion of a metal
(C) Same rates of expansion of two different metals
(D) Different rates of expansion of two different metals

6. When a balloon rises into the air, it ______________.


(A) Expands on cooling
(B) Contracts on cooling

(C)

Expands on heating

(D) Contracts on heating

7. Small gaps are left in between slabs of concrete on sidewalks to


allow the _______________.
(A) contraction of the concrete
(B) connection between
slabs
(C) expansion of the concrete
(D) replacement of slabs
8. Pyrex glass is different from ordinary glass because
___________________.
(A) Expands a lot on heating
(B) contracts a lot on
heating
(C) expands a little on heating
(D) contracts a little on
heating
